Text
All persons, other than temporary employees, serving in the state civil service and engaged in the performance of a function transferred to the Division of Resource Conservation, Department of Conservation or engaged in the administration of a law, the administration of which is transferred to said division, shall remain in the state civil service and are hereby transferred to the division on the effective date of this act. The status, positions, and rights of such persons shall not be affected by their transfer and shall continue to be retained by them pursuant to the State Civil Service Act, except as to positions the duties of which are vested in a position that is exempt from civil service.
